The Process of Hiring: Inquiries and Warning Signs
When embarking on your home remodeling endeavor, asking the right questions is essential to ensure you pick the right remodeler. Start with inquiries about their experience and credentials. For example purposes, find out about past projects like yours and whether they can furnish testimonials from past clients. Understanding their methodology and schedule is also important, as it helps you evaluate how they intend to realize your plans. In addition, ask regarding their communication style, as effective communication is crucial for a smooth remodel.
Just as important is being watchful for warning signs during the hiring process. A remodeler who seems reluctant to provide documentation or documentation of their license and insurance should raise concerns. Watch for any vagueness in their quote or a hesitance to put terms in writing. If they urge you to make a choice or request a large upfront payment, take it as a red flag, as reputable contractors usually provide comprehensive bids and give homeowners time to think about their decision.
In the end, trust your instincts throughout the hiring process. If a remodeler seems excessively enthusiastic or makes promises that feel too good to be true, it's crucial to pause. The top remodelers respect your vision while giving truthful input and direction.
